What is Anydesk App?
How to use anydesk to remotely access devices

Anydesk app is a remote access program that is available for download on a wide variety of operating systems. AnyDesk offers one of the most user-friendly options for remote access.

The Anydesk application enables numerous users to remotely access their home computers while traveling, and without going to an online platform, you can easily gain access to another device.

The IT departments of many organizations require the Anydesk application to monitor and resolve issues with the organization’s computers. The Anydesk App offers encrypted and reliable remote connections to the customer.

You may share your AnyDesk number with a colleague or request that they establish a remote connection. AnyDesk is a performer; it offers low user latencies and high framerates, both of which are designed to make their work more manageable.

AnyDesk has numerous security frameworks within the application, preventing strangers from contacting you and limiting their access capabilities. In addition, every connection is validated by RSA 2048 asymmetric encryption, and their servers operate on purpose-built Erlang telecommunications technology.

AnyDesk enables you to remotely access different devices and transfer files, documents, or applications from anywhere globally. The AnyDesk for Windows PC can be accessed via mobile devices as well. It can be used everywhere and at any time on Android phones.

Start AnyDesk

Let’s start the main process of how to use AnyDesk. After the installation is finished, open AnyDesk on each remote desktop software(both the presenter and the user) and proceed with the execution of the program. This action launches the AnyDesk application interface.

AnyDesk interface

The program user interface includes two primary fields for remote control of Windows PC and Mac users. AnyDesk works a quick and secure connection across systems with a primary ID. This Desk: This field displays the AnyDesk address of the computer you are using at the moment.

In the field labeled “Remote Desk,” type the AnyDesk address (ID or alias) of the computer you want to access remotely. Tap the “Connect” button after you have typed the address of the remote machine into the field labeled “Remote Desk.”

How to Set Anydesk Without Accepting (Unattended Access)

After accepting, the device asks for your permission before it can access your data as a safety precaution against unauthorized connections or becoming out of control. You can configure a password and two-factor authentication for unattended access under your security settings.

Nonetheless, if the source is legitimate, it will be somewhat annoying and obstructive. You can access a computer remotely without requesting permission from anyone. Anydesk allows users to skip a session by allowing or offering password protection features.

Ensuring protection by adding passwords is simple and clear. To make changes, please navigate to the settings menu— > security —> unlock security settings. Enter the desired password after Ceklis “Enable unattended access.”

How to Access a Remote Client?

The remote operator enters their AnyDesk-ID or Alias, which can be located in the “This Desk” (pre-AnyDesk 7) or “Your Identify” (AnyDesk 7+) field, respectively. The visitor must then enter the ID/Alias from the previous phase into the “Remote Desk” field.

Submit a remote session by entering the ID/Alias in the Address label on the remote computer. If the connection request is valid, the remote device will display the Accept Windows. Accepting the connection request establishes the first session.

Permission Profiles and Interactive Access each contain additional information regarding the Accept Window’s Permissions and Settings.

For unattended access, you might need a response from the remotely controlled Windows PC or set a password. One can connect a mobile device to a pc. It also shows all the features you can print remotely, file transfer, screen mirroring, and use a whiteboard.

On the whiteboard, we are able to draw sketches or point in the desired direction in order to communicate with the remote side.

Additional considerations

As you’ve made your work computer accessible via the Internet, here are a few things to keep in mind.

  • Recruit a secure password.
  • Use a password that you don’t use elsewhere.
  • You can control who can remotely connect to this computer by restricting access to it based on the AnyDesk IDs they use in the security settings.

Always make sure to lock the remote Computer before you disconnect from it using your remote desktop connection. You can complete this by pressing the AnyDesk icon and then choosing “Ctrl+Alt+Del” from the drop-down menu that appears.

This will cause a signal to be transmitted to the remote PC that contains the keys CTRL, ALT, and DEL. At this point, you should see a blue screen with the option to “Lock.” After locking the remote PC, you can safely end your AnyDesk session remotely.
